Technological Advancements in Imaging Equipment

High-Resolution Scanning

The ability to capture high-resolution images has significantly enhanced diagnostic accuracy. Advancements in CT scan technology mean patients receive quicker and more precise diagnoses, leading to increased usage of contrast media in scans.

Tailored Contrast Agents

Recent innovations have introduced contrast agents that cater to specific medical needs, reducing side effects and improving patient experience. Tailored contrast media has driven healthcare facilities to upgrade and expand their imaging toolkit, facilitating increased demand at a global scale.

Growing Chronic Disease Incidence

Rise in Chronic Conditions

With the rise in global life expectancy, chronic diseases such as cardiovascular diseases, cancers, and neurological disorders are more prevalent. These conditions frequently require detailed imaging studies, often utilizing CT contrast media to detect and monitor disease progression.

Enhanced Diagnostic Protocols

Many healthcare systems and protocols have been updated to include routine imaging, particularly for patients with chronic conditions. With a larger patient pool requiring consistent monitoring, the demand for CT contrast media has correspondingly risen.

The Aging Population

Global Demographic Shifts

It's no secret that the world population is aging. Countries like Japan, Germany, and the U.S. are facing increased healthcare demands from their senior citizens. CT scans, highly effective for identifying age-related conditions such as osteoporosis and vascular issues, rely on contrast media for efficacy, thereby heightening demand.

Increasing Healthcare Expenditure

Government Initiatives

Healthcare funding and government-backed initiatives to improve diagnostic capabilities are increasing. Many governments are prioritizing early diagnosis, leading to an upswing in CT scan utilization.

Investment in Health Infrastructure

Developing nations in particular are witnessing enhanced healthcare infrastructure investments. State-of-the-art hospitals and diagnostic centers are equipping themselves with modern CT equipment, propelling the need for CT contrast media in these regions.

Expanding Application Areas

Broadening Medical Applications

While traditionally utilized for cardiovascular evaluations and oncology diagnostics, the range of CT applications has grown. Contrast media is now being employed in gastrointestinal, musculoskeletal, and emergency room imaging, broadening the market horizon.

Personalization of Treatment

The ability of precision medicine to tailor treatment to individual patients emphasizes detailed imaging analysis, encouraging higher CT contrast media utilization.

Economic Factors

Cost-Effectiveness

CT imaging, while highly detailed and diagnostic-focused, is also cost-effective compared to other imaging modalities like MRI. As hospitals and patients optimize costs, CT scans with contrast media are often preferred.

Insurance Coverage Ease

In many countries, insurance providers prefer covering CT scans because of their reliability and cost-effectiveness, thus driving more patients towards opting for contrast-enhanced scans.

Challenges and Opportunities

Addressing Safety Concerns

Patient safety, particularly concerning allergic reactions and renal effects, remains a primary concern. The industry's proactive efforts towards developing safer formulations represent both a challenge and an opportunity for growth.

Navigating Regulatory Hurdles

The approval process for new contrast agents by regulatory bodies is vital yet intricate. Companies must navigate these pathways efficiently, ensuring compliance while fostering innovation.
